Pug Characteristics
Pugs are actively bred as lap dogs and crave human companionship. They’re very sensitive, and though they're ideal for apartment living because of their size and personality, they will not appreciate being left home alone for long periods of time. These dogs can be a bit stubborn when they're being house trained, but overall, they're very affectionate and are perfect candidates for beginner pet parents.

Folklore states that the Pug's name comes from the Latin word for "fist" because his face resembles a human fist. The pug's face will bring smiles to nearly anyone who sees it, and its lovable personality will charm the rest. Their heads are large and round, as are their eyes. They have deep and distinct wrinkles on their faces. Legend has it that the Chinese, who are masters of breeding Pugs, prized these wrinkles because they resembled good luck symbols in their language.
Full-grown pugs typically weigh in between 14-18 pounds and stand around 10-14 inches tall at the shoulder. Often found with fawn, black, or white coats, their small and stout stature makes them perfect apartment companions and are best kept indoors. Pugs, like Bulldogs, don't do well in extreme climates because the shape of their nose makes it difficult for them to regulate their temperatures.
Pugs are also known to enjoy eating just a little too much. It is important to monitor their diet and provide them with ample exercise, or else they are prone to excess weight gain. Pugs have a short, double coat and are known for extreme shedding. Regular brushing and grooming will be necessary in order to keep your pug clean and happy.
How dog-friendly is Tampa?
A recent study from WalletHub analyzed the 100 largest US cities to see which are the most pet-friendly. In the study, Tampa is ranked as the 2nd most pet-friendly of all American cities. The city is one of the best when it comes to pet health and wellness and outdoor pet-friendliness, ranking 5th and 13th in the categories, respectively.
A similar study from SmartAsset also ranked Tampa as the 2nd most pet-friendly city in the country. In the study, they found Tampa to have the 6th most dog parks per capita. The city also has the 18th most pet-friendly restaurants and one of the highest walkability scores.
Dog parks and outdoor activities in Tampa
Tampa has a variety of dog parks and other outdoor activities for your dog to enjoy the warm Florida sun. According to the SmartAsset study, there are 4.1 dog parks per 100,000 residents. Some of the most popular off-leash dog parks in the city include West Park Dog Park, Deputy Kotfila Memorial Dog Park, Lettuce Lake Park, and Hair of the Dog Park.
In Tampa, you’ll also find several scenic hiking trails for when you want to take your dog on an extended walk. A couple of great spots to explore are Eureka Springs Conservation Park and Upper Tampa Bay Trail.
Life in Tampa with a dog
With over 240 pet-friendly restaurants, you and your pup will always have somewhere to grab a bite to eat. A few of the most popular dog-friendly restaurants in the city are Datz Tampa, Mad Dogs & Englishmen, World of Beer, Independent Bar and Cafe, and Glory Days Grill.
Tampa has many other dog-friendly businesses, including pet stores, daycares, groomers, and spas. It is also one of the best locations when it comes time to find a place to live with your pet. A Zumper study found Tampa to have the 32nd most pet-friendly rental listings in the country.
If your friends or family are in Tampa for a visit, they’ll find plenty of pet-friendly hotels where they can stay with their dogs. Some of the most popular dog-friendly hotels in the city include Brandon Center Hotel, Le Meridien Tampa, Hotel Haya, and Seminole Hard Rock Hotel & Casino.
Popular dog breeds in Tampa
Tampa is home to a diverse range of dog breeds. Some of the most popular breeds in the city are French Bulldogs, Goldens, Labs, German Shepherds, Bulldogs, Poodles, Rottweilers, Boxers, Doberman Pinschers, and Yorkshire Terriers. No matter which breed you want to add to your family, your new pup will find many of its kind across the city.
